Elk Creek village Nebraska (NE) Special Trade Contractors
Local Elk Creek village Nebraska (NE) Special Trade Contractors with reviews.
No search results found.
Local Elk Creek village Nebraska (NE) Special Trade Contractors with reviews.
No search results found.